Short Track Super Series Combined Event Set For June 8th At Big Diamond Speedway

Story By: CHRIS MOORE / SHORT TRACK SUPER SERIES – MINERSVILLE, PA – On Tuesday, June 8, the Bob Hilbert Sportswear Short Track Super Series (STSS) Fueled By Sunoco returns to Big Diamond Speedway for the sixth running of the ‘Anthracite Assault.’

The 50-lap, $5,000-to-win Modified headliner is annually one of the biggest events on the STSS calendar. The best of the Hurlock Auto & Speed North Region and the Velocita-USA South Region presented by Design for Vision and Sunglass Central face each other in the only event all year that carries points for both regions.

The ‘North vs South’ event has been run every year since 2015, except when ‘Mother Nature’ washed out the 2018 edition.

The battle at the three-eighths-mile oval in Coal Country will be Round No. 6 in the South Region and the fourth round of the season for the North Region.

Crate 602 Sportsman take part in the program with a 25-lap, $1,500-to-win Belmont’s Garage South Region program.

Billy Pauch Jr. was victorious in the ‘Anthracite Assault’ in 2020, sliding by Jimmy Horton in lapped traffic and winning his third career STSS race. Horton, Mike Gular, Tyler Dippel, and Richie Pratt Jr. rounded out the top five.
